- W2314582562 abstract "The episodes of the tre ombre in Inferno XVI and the frati godenti in Inferno XXIII are analogous in that Guido Guerra, Tegghiaio Aldobrandi and lacopo Rusticucci, and Catalano de' Malavolti and Loderingo degli Andalo, were all players on the political stage of Florence during the middle third of the 13th century when the conflict between the Guelfs and the Ghibellines reached its climax. Dante ties these two encounters between pilgrim and sinners much closer by introducing linguistic and structural parallels. These parallels have not come to the notice of Dante scholars before now. They enhance the relevance of the encounters by establishing an overt connection between them.
